*本サイトはアフィリエイトプログラムを利用しています。
Magento(マジェント)は、全世界で活用されているECプラットフォームの一つです。Magentoは無料で利用でき、多くの企業で利用されています。
本記事では、Magento(マジェンド)の概要や機能とメリット、導入手順、注意点などを解説します。
Magento (マジェント)とは?
-1024x555.jpg)
Magento(マジェント)は、Adobe社が提供するオープンソースのECプラットフォームです。かつてMagentoの提供元はMadento社(米国)でしたが、2018年にAdobe社が同サービスを買収しました。
Adobe社が提供するECプラットフォームは、無料のMagentoと有料のAdobeCommerceに分かれます。この記事で主に紹介するのは、無料の「Magento(マジェント)」です。
オープンソースECプラットフォームの基礎知識
ECサイトの開発方法には複数の種類があります。その一つが、オープンソースという方法です。オープンソースとは、外部に公開されているソースコード(プログラム)を使ってECサイトを構築する方法です。
オープンソースで開発するメリットとして、プラットフォーム自体の費用が安いことが挙げられます。またソースコードが公開されているため、スキルがあれば誰でも導入できることも大きなメリットです。
一方で、カスタマイズを行う際には技術を要することがデメリットです。また外部公開されている関係でセキュリティ面のトラブルが起こる可能性があるため、最大限の注意を払う必要があります。
Magentoの基本的な特徴
Magentoの特徴の一つめは、カスタマイズ性が高い点です。前項で説明した通り、ソースコードが公開されており、コード変更によるカスタマイズが可能です。これにより、企業は自社のニーズに合わせて、サイトを細かく調整することができます。
二つめは、国際標準である60以上の言語と50種類以上の通貨に対応していることです。多くの言語に対応しているため、複数の言語圏、通貨圏の市場をもつビジネスにとって、最適なECサイトと言えるでしょう。
三つめは、全世界に広がる大規模な開発者コミュニティが存在することです。このコミュニティでは情報交換のみならず、構築支援や拡張機能なども提供されています。
無料版と有料版の違い
無料版(Magento)と有料版(AdobeCommerce)で利用可能な機能に違いがあります。
例えばMagentoでは、見積もり機能やポイント・ギフト機能、レポート機能は利用できません。またサポートも無料コミュニティによるサービスに留まります。
より高機能なECサイトを求める企業の多くは、有料版のAdobeCommerceを使用しています。
でECサイト構築・運用支援-Shopifyの作成・制作、運用代行.jpg)
Magentoの主な機能とメリット
Magentoの機能とメリットを3つ紹介します。
複数サイト運営を一括管理できる
Magentoは、一つの管理画面で複数のECサイトを運営できます。これは異なる国や地域ごとに別のECサイトとして運営したい場合や、複数のブランドやショップを運営していてサイトを分けたい場合に大きなメリットです。
多くのECプラットフォームでは、それぞれのサイトごとに管理画面を用意することになり、設定の手間が増えてしまいます。Magentoなら、複数サイトの管理負担が大幅に減ることが期待できます。
豊富なカスタマイズオプション
Magentoでは基本機能以外にもカスタマイズオプションが豊富に用意されています。
例えば、顧客に応じて表示価格を切り替えたり、閲覧ユーザーのログインの有無に応じて表示内容を変えるといったカスタマイズも可能です。
Magentoの豊富な拡張性を実現させているのは、エクステンションと呼ばれるオプションで、サイトの機能拡張ができます。エクステンションはなんと6000種類以上もあります。
他にもMagentoのカスタマイズは日々幅が広がっているため、今後もより良いECサイトとなることが見込めるでしょう。
SEO対策
MagentoはSEO(検索エンジン最適化)対策を日々実施しているため、Googleをはじめとする検索エンジンでも上位表示を狙いやすいです。またサイト内の全ページへのアクセス設定、サイトマップとメタデータの作成などを通じて、検索エンジンから効率よく集客する道を作り上げます。
今日では多くの人が検索エンジンを通じてサービスや商品を認知するため、この領域の作業効率化は業務コストの削減にもつながります。
Magentoの導入手順
Magentoを導入してECサイトを構築する際の大まかな手順を解説します。
- ホスティング環境を用意する
- Magentoを公式サイトからダウンロードする
- ダウンロードしたMagentoをサーバにアップロードする
- ECサイトの設定をする
- ECサイトのデザインをする
- 商品を追加する
- 追加機能をインストールする
- テストし、公開する
Magentoの動作環境については、Adobe Commerceの公式サイトをご確認ください。Magentoを構築するには、フロントエンド・バックエンド両面のIT知識とスキルが必要になります。特にデータ管理には最新の注意を払う必要もあるため、自信のない方は専門家への依頼を検討しましょう。
Magentoの構築に求められる主なスキルは以下の通りです。
- HTML/CSS
- JavaScript
- PHP
- SQL
- サーバー管理(Apacheまたはnginx)
など
Magentoを導入する際の注意点
多くの魅力を持つMagentoですが、導入時には注意すべきことがあります。
習得の難易度が高い
Magentoは機能が多く拡張性も高いですが、その分習得の難易度は低くありません。
Magentoの良さであるカスタマイズ性を効果的に引き出すためには、構造の理解だけでなく、プログラミング言語のPHPやSQL、サーバー管理などバックエンドのスキルが欠かせません。またECサイトのデザインなどに関わるHTML、CSS、JavaScriptなど、フロントエンドの知識なども必要になります。さらにマニュアルは基本的に英語のため、専門的な内容を英語で読解する力が必要です。
自社にスキルを持った人材がいるか、または育成できるかなどを慎重に検討しましょう。もし自社に適切な人材がいない場合には外注という方法もあります。ただし外注する際には、費用がかかるため注意してください。
作り込みに時間がかかる
オープンソースであるMagentoは独自の機能やデザインをできる反面、作り込む際には多くの時間が必要です。特に初めてMagentoで構築する際には、ソースコードや構造、機能などの理解だけでも多くの工数を要します。
規模や複雑さによっては、開発には数ヶ月から1年以上かかることも珍しくありません。
開発期間や費用が十分に確保できない場合には、専門スキルを必要としないECプラットフォームなど、別の選択肢も視野にいれるといいでしょう。
ECサイトを作るならShopifyも
Magentoと同じようにECサイトを構築できるプラットフォームとして、「Shopify(ショッピファイ)」があります。
ShopifyはASP型のECプラットフォームで、サーバを用意したり、複雑な設定を行なったりする必要がありません。またノーコードでサイトを構築できるため、専門的な技術やスキルがも不要です。それでいて費用が安く、カスタマイズ性が高いのが特徴です。
スキルがない、制作予算を抑えたい、早くリリースしたいという方には、特におすすめです。以下の記事で詳細を解説しているため、ぜひ参考にしてください。
大規模なEC事業者におすすめのMagento
この記事ではオープンソースのECプラットフォーム「Magento」について解説しました。
Magentoを最大限活用するには、専門的なスキルや技術を持った方の協力が必要不可欠です。そのため、自社でIT部門などを用意できるような大規模なEC事業者に向いているECプラットフォームと言えるでしょう。
その分カスタマイズ性に優れ、自社独自のデザインや機能をもたせることができます。万全の運用体制を構築できる事業者の方はぜひ、導入を検討してみてください。
おすすめShopifyアプリ
